NVR OPERATION MODES

ONSSI’s NVRs can operate in two modes: Server mode or Workstation (WS) mode.

Server mode is used when there is no need to view the live or playback video directly on the Server station screens, usually when the NVR is located on a rack in a computer room, closet or unmanned location. Access to video is done via the NetGuard or NetGuard-EVS remote clients (NetDVMS or NetDVR) or via the Microsoft Internet Explorer browser-based client (NetDVMS, NetDVR or ProSight).

Operating in Server Mode will lower the CPU and video card requirements, as the system does not need to decompress video for on-screen presentation. The hardware used is usually rack-mountable server class hardware.

This mode is strongly recommended for NetDVR, and should be the only mode used for NetDVMS.

Workstation (WS) mode is used when there is a need to view live or playback video directly on the workstation screens, usually when the NVR is located next to an operator. This mode is not recommended for NetDVMS or NetDVR. For recommended hardware for Workstation Mode please see our NVR Hardware and Storage Calculator. Workstation Mode is recommended only for use with the ProSight Series.

HOW TO CHOOSE THE CORRECT HARDWARE?

ONSSI has set a standard method of scaling and measuring the hardware performance to allow for easy selection of the proper hardware.

Selecting the proper hardware is directly related to the total Frames Per Second (FPS) generated while the NVR simultaneously displays live video, records, and plays back video. (Most NVR manufacturers measure this number only by live view or recorded video or playback, but not all at the same time).

CALCULATING YOUR SYSTEM'S TOTAL FRAMES PERSECOND (FPS)

To find out the total FPS required in your system, follow these steps:

  1. Add the recording FPS speed required of each camera.
    # of Cameras _____ x Camera FSP ____ = Total FPS = ____
  2. Repeat for all cameras of different frame rates.
  3. Now add all FPS to a total FPS and match this number to the next higher FPS listing in the Recommended Workstation or Server listing bellow.

Example:

If you have 6 cameras that need to be recorded at 7 FPS in CIF format and 9 cameras that need to be recorded at 8 FPS in 4CIF format, the total CIF/FPS will be:

6 cameras x 7 FPS = 42 FPS
+
9 cameras x 8 FPS = 72 FPS

Total: 114 FPS

Notes:

  1. The above calculations are suitable for non-megapixel cameras only. To determine the minimum recommended hardware and storage for a system incorporating megapixel cameras, please refer to the OnSSI Hardware and Storage Calculator.
  2. The FPS performance values are estimated based on performance tests conducted by OnSSI. You should design the system with additional margins to allow for errors. Note regarding compatibility with Windows Vista Operating System.

General:

Windows Vista's User Access Control (UAC) needs to be disabled in order to run OnSSI software. Instructions to do this are available here.

NVRs:

NetDVR 6.0 and NetDVMS 6.0 are certified to run on Windows Vista Business or Vista Ultimate (Windows XP Professional and Windows 2003 Server are supported by all OnSSI’s NVRs.)

Video Clients:

NetGuard-EVS – compatible with Windows Vista (Business or Ultimate)

NetGuard Remote Client – only the versions of the NetGuard Remote Client supplied with the latest NVR versions (NetDVMS 6.0 and NetDVR 6.0) are compatible with Windows Vista (Business or Ultimate). Earlier versions will not run on Vista.

NetPDA and NetCell:

NetPDA Server and NetCell Server will not run on Windows Vista.

HARDWARE RECOMMENDATIONS FOR NETGUARD AND NETGUARD-EVS

The NetGuard Remote Client software can be installed on any PC that runs an updated version of Microsoft Windows 2000, 2003, XP or Vista (Vista is supported on the latest versions of NetDVMS and NetDVR only).

There is no limitation in running the NetGuard on any PC, however, to ensure minimum performance please consider the following:

  • As a rule, a P4 processor with speed of 2.8MHz or higher is recommended.
  • The PC should have 32MB of RAM for every live or playback video stream presented on the screen. To view 16 cameras on the screen the PC should have 512MB RAM (32MB x 16), to view 4 cameras the PC should have 128MB RAM.

A typical NetGuard configuration of dual screen, 16 cameras per screen, would thus require a P4 machine, 3.4 GHz, 1 GB of RAM and a 128 MB PCIe video card.

The PC should also have a minimum of 128 MB Video RAM on its video card. Larger Video RAM will provide better FPS and refresh rate.

The NetGuard-EVS clients requires a .Net-enabled machine. .Net is supported natively in Windows XP and Vista, and is downloadable for Windows 2000 machines from Microsoft.

HARDWARE RECOMMENDATION FOR THE NETPDA AND NETCELL PRODUCT LINE

Currently the NetPDA/NetCell client software can run only on Windows CE or Windows Mobile (Mobile5 and Mobile 6). Tested models include to date the HP iPaq H4550 , HP iPaq H4250 , HP iPaq H5550 , Dell Axion, Audiovox 6700/6800 and Treo 700W.

Units running Windows Mobile 6.0/6.1 are not necessarily supported, each unit should be tested to verify compatibility, the following Mobile 6.0/6.1 models are known to work properly:

  • HTC-8900 (Mobile 6.0)
  • HTC Touch Pro XV6850 (Mobile 6.1)
  • Samsung i760 (Mobile 6.1)
  • Samsung SCH-i910 (Mobile 6.1)

 The following units are not supported:

  • Motorola Q
  • HTC 621s
  • Verizon’s SMT5800

The NetPDA/NetCell clients support MJPEG and MPEG4, they do not support H.264.

As a rule of thumb, the handheld device's processor speed will affect the frame rate of live and playback video; a faster processor will provide a faster frame rate. Most models that support a 320x240 screen resolution will perform well. Higher screen resolutions would require faster a CPU and would not necessarily yield better picture quality due to the handheld devices' small screen size.

HARDWARE RECOMMENDATIONS FOR NETSWITCHER (INCLUDING NETMATRIX VIEWER)

The following recommendations reflect the hardware components currently available on the market.

This section describes the recommended hardware for use with the OnSSI NetSwitcher and NetMatrix Viewer. ONSSI software products, being open-architecture, can operate on any PC hardware platform by any manufacturer, as long as it complies with the minimum requirements described below.

The NetSwitcher software consists of 4 components:

  • NetSwitcher AServer - This server contains the main matrix switch engine, database and maps and should be a RAID Server class hardware.
  • NetSwitcher Controller - Operator's control panel interface to operate the matrix switch.
  • NetSwitcher Viewer - This module provides the display monitor function on a video wall. A single PC can drive 1-2 monitors and each monitor can provide a single or quad view.
  • NetSwitcher Administrator - this administration module is installed on either the NetSwitcher Server or the NetSwitcher Controller PCs. It has no effect on system performance. In the specifications list below, it is included in the NetSwitcher Controller specifications.

Minimum Hardware Recommendation for NetSwitcher Viewer (including NetMatrix Viewer)

In calculating the number of NetSwitcher viewer PCs and the specs for each, please note:

  1. The maximum number of camera streams per NetSwitcher Viewer PC depends on the parameters of the camera streams displayed - framerate, resolution, compression format, etc. Displaying a large number of megapixel cameras, for example, might result in degraded video quality.
  2. The number of screens per NetSwitcher Viewer PC depends to a great extent on the video card's properties. As a rule of thumb, the video card should have 256 MB of on-card RAM per screen (i.e. a dual screen card should have minimum 512 MB of RAM, and a quad card 1 GB of RAM).
